This book explores the metaphysical and spiritual dimensions of human existence through a collection of poignant and thought-provoking poems. The author explores themes of love, loss, faith, and purpose, inviting the reader to contemplate the deeper meanings of life's experiences. The poems delve into universal truths, drawing upon imagery from nature, human relationships, and religious traditions to convey profound insights. By examining the human condition through a spiritual lens, this book offers a unique and insightful perspective on the nature of reality and our place within it. Through the power of poetry, the author invites us to transcend the boundaries of the mundane and connect with a higher consciousness.
